Richard Woods transforms real surfaces into cartoon-like versions. His art combines art, architecture and design. He uses household gloss paint, plywood and laminate to transform urban buildings into mock-Tudor cottages; he coats concrete pillars with chinz wallpaper, and covers floors with crazy paving in different colours.
For Liverpool Biennial, Woods has made a very special edition titled Big L – with the 'L' standing for Liverpool. This new work is a celebration of Innovation-Investment-Progress, his commission in the old Rapid Hardware store for the Liverpool Biennial Festival in 2008. Woods created a statement around positive thinking, using an iconic former DIY shop to create a repeated pattern of ‘feel-good’ logos. These logos included words like ‘innovation’, ‘progress’ and ‘build’ and were in situ alongside a floor covered in zig-zag fake wood print.
